Maximum Capacity Policy

The Society recognizes the need to determine a maximum capacity due to the constraints of parking space. The need to park safely, legally and to be prepared in case of an emergency is vital to the success of the Society.It is the intention of the Board of Directors to provide a quality trail system for the enjoyment and safety of all snowmobilers and to support environmental stewardship.   

The Society will accept vehicles for parking up to capacity of the parking lots as determined by on site parking

attendants or the manager.  Excess vehicles will be turned away and the parking lots closed.  Overnight RV Parking

will not be permitted.  A maximum of 1000 trail passes will be sold between all booth locations.
